Oil on panel signed Jean Frélaut * representing a marine landscape with a sailboat sailing in the Gulf of Morbihan on a beautiful sunny day, vintage twentieth century.

This painting is in very good condition; Signed lower right (date illegible).

A report: tiny small accidents of time on the frame, see photos.

* Jean Frélaut (1879-1954):

The painter-engraver is in his time an artist representative of the Breton landscape, if any. Coming from a Morbihan family, he chose to settle in Vannes where he lived his youth rather than to seek in Paris the vanities of a worldly success. His thousands of drawings and watercolors, his thousand four hundred and thirty-four engravings and some six hundred paintings draw their beauty from them. Painter of sincerity and emotion, Jean Frélaut has also excelled in printmaking and book illustration.
